Patience, counting days from spotting is spotty,  a previously experienced sire will show zero interest for sometime up to days after the counting method says it's right. Then it'll be a slam bam thank you maam. I fiddled with getting antsy and that messing with veterinary help on the side by side AI deal cut the females life short.
